UN Chief Urges Immediate Ceasefire Amid Escalating Middle East Conflict

Antonio Guterres calls for de-escalation in Lebanon and condemns Iranian missile attacks on Israel.

Overview

  • UN Secretary-General Antonio Guterres has called for an immediate ceasefire in Lebanon to prevent an all-out war.
  • Guterres emphasized the need to respect Lebanon's sovereignty and territorial integrity.
  • The UN has reported sporadic incursions by the Israeli military into Lebanon but no full-scale invasion.
  • Iran launched a wave of missiles at Israel, prompting Guterres to condemn the 'broadening conflict' in the region.
  • Israel has responded to the UN's ceasefire call by criticizing Guterres for not directly condemning Iran's actions.
